As soon as baby’s first tooth erupts, it’s time to start brushing. Milk or baby teeth play an important role when it comes to eating, chewing, and speaking. Therefore, tiny choppers need a lot of care. Choose a super-gentle toothbrush for baby’s first toothbrush, as babies don’t like hard bristles that stress or hurt the sensitive gums. A rice grain-sized amount of a children’s toothpaste with an age-appropriated fluoride level is enough. Brush with small circles and clean the tiny teeth thoroughly and cautiously, without any pressure. Firstly, brush the inner side, then the outer side, and eventually the chewing surfaces. The earlier you start brushing, the more natural this process will become for your child.
No. A hard baby toothbrush or a stiff kids’ toothbrush hurts the sensitive gums, which may be extra delicate because a tooth is coming through. A toothbrush that's too hard can hurt and cause pain—and it can also scare your kid, so they won't want to open their mouth next time. A super-soft toothbrush is way better, builds trust, and encourages children to cooperate, as they learn that a soft toothbrush does not hurt.

Also, a good setting, enough light, a well-placed mirror, singing while brushing or telling fun stories, and parents who lead by example will help children to acquire a good habit.
At around the age of 4, your child can switch from the baby toothbrush to a larger kids toothbrush. Children will have more teeth by this time and a larger toothbrush will provide a larger and denser cleaning surface. The kids toothbrush is ideal as it comes with ultra-soft bristles and a practical handle which allows your child to hold the brush properly.
Yes. Children older than 6 years can use our Hydrosonic sonic toothbrushes. They should start with the sensitive brush head and level 1, then gradually increase the intensity to get to know the cleaning power and the hydrodynamic effect. Until the age of 10, parents should brush their child's teeth or at least check the results and continue to supervise their kid during brushing until at least 12 years of age.
